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Green Sweet Peppers vs Stewed Canned Tomatoes:
500 calories of Green Sweet Peppers have 2.6 times more Vitamin A, 1.6 times more Vitamin B1, 17.1 times more Vitamin B6, 2.6 times more Vitamin B9, 13.2 times more Vitamin C and 4 times more Vitamin K than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
While 500 kcal of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 1.7 times more Vitamin E than Raw Green Sweet Peppers.
Both Green Sweet Peppers and Stewed Canned Tomatoes prov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2, Vitamin B3 and Vitamin B5 per 500 calories.
Both Raw Green Sweet Peppers as well as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 500 calories.
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Green Sweet Peppers vs Stewed Canned Tomatoes:
500 calories of Green Sweet Peppers have 2.7 times more Manganese, 1.3 times more Phosphorus and 1.3 times more Water than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
While 500 kcal of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 2.6 times more Calcium, 1.3 times more Copper, 3 times more Iron, more Selenium and 56.7 times more Sodium than Raw Green Sweet Peppers.
Both Green Sweet Peppers and Stewed Canned Tomatoes contain similar levels of Magnesium, Potassium and Zinc per 500 calories.

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Green Sweet Peppers have 3.5 times more Omega 3, 2.2 times more Fiber and 1.2 times more Protein than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
While 500 kcal of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 1.3 times more Fructose than Raw Green Sweet Peppers.
Both Green Sweet Peppers and Stewed Canned Tomatoes offer comparable quantities of Energy, Carbohydrate and Sugars per 500 calories.
